Problem

Find the area of a triangle with base $1 \frac{2}{3}$ inches and height 11 inches? Write your answer as a proper fraction or mixed number in reduced form.

Steps

Step 1 :The area of a triangle is given by the formula \(\frac{1}{2} \times \text{base} \times \text{height}\).

Step 2 :In this case, the base is \(1 \frac{2}{3}\) inches and the height is 11 inches.

Step 3 :We need to calculate the area using these values.

Step 4 :Substitute the given values into the formula: \(\frac{1}{2} \times 1 \frac{2}{3} \times 11\).

Step 5 :Simplify the expression to get the area: \(\frac{55}{6}\) square inches.

Step 6 :Final Answer: The area of the triangle is \(\boxed{\frac{55}{6}}\) square inches.
